How Our Sewage Water Removal Process Works
At the heart of our sewage water removal process is a commitment to speed, safety, and effectiveness. We understand that every minute counts when dealing with sewage water, which is why our team is available 24/7 to respond to emergencies. Get help fast and let our experts handle the rest.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our technicians will arrive quickly to assess the situation and contain the sewage water to prevent further damage. Stop the spread with our expert containment methods.
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to remove the sewage water and waste, leaving your property clean and dry. Get rid of the mess with our powerful extraction tools.
Step 3: Disinfection and Sanitizing
We’ll disinfect and sanitize all affected areas to prevent the growth of bacteria, mold, and mildew. Keep your home safe with our comprehensive disinfection services.
Step 4: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ected areas, preventing further damage and ensuring your property is safe and healthy. Get back to normal with our expert drying services.

Sewage Water Removal Cost in Victoria, MN
The cost of sewage water removal in Victoria, MN,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on real-world costs and may vary depending on the specifics of your situation. Get a free estimate today and let us help you recover from sewage water dam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$200 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Water Removal and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, equipment needed |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of disinfection need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ed |
| Equipment Rental and Labor |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ed |
| Free Estimate and Consultation | Free | None |
